Composite Door Hinge Replacement
Hinges can be adjusted if your composite door is difficult to open or shut. It's important to understand your hinge type and make sure you have the right tools prior to making adjustments.
Hinges require regular maintenance to ensure they function as they were intended. This includes cleaning to avoid build up and lubrication to reduce friction.
Preparation
It could be time to adjust your hinges if you find that your composite door lock replacement door does not close correctly. It may seem like a daunting task however, with the right tools and patience you can accomplish this task.
It is crucial to first identify the kind of hinge that is installed. Different types have unique adjustments that must be considered as a lack of understanding could cause damage to the hinge or frame.
It is recommended to always seek the assistance of a professional. They'll have the experience and knowledge required to ensure that your doors made of composite are correctly adjusted. They'll also be able use special tools that aren't included in a standard household toolkit, making the process faster and more efficient.
Before you begin to adjust your doors made of composite it is important to make initial preparations. Examine the area for moisture that may affect the wood and make any adjustments that are needed. You should also examine the hinges to see if there are any areas that require attention. In the end, you must grease the hinges and the door to decrease friction and increase wear.
First, you'll need to remove the plastic caps from the hinges. The next step is to find the screws for each hinge. These will be located either on the door-side of the hinge or on the plate attached to the door frame. You'll need a screwdriver, or an Allen key to open the hinges.
You'll then need to turn the screw clockwise a few times to loosen it. This will allow you to move the hinge plate up or down, depending on the direction it's stuck in. After you've made the necessary adjustments make sure you tighten the screw to test the door.

Adjustment
Over time the door made of composite may be swollen, warped or bow. This can cause gaps in the frame, which can affect how your door shuts and opens. The good news is that this can usually be corrected with a simple hinge adjustment. This work must be done correctly to protect the frame and make sure that the doors operate exactly as they should.
The first step is to prepare the hinge area. Use a utility blade to cut off the existing mortise. This will allow you to make a new one larger enough to accommodate the new hinge plate. Then, you can use a chisel and remove any excess wood around the mortise. After that you can use a screwdriver to join the new screws by drilling three screw holes.
After the new screws have been attached, you can proceed to adjust your door hinges made of composite. It is crucial to determine the kind of hinge you own since each comes with a different method to adjust it. For example, some types of hinges are flagged, which means that the lateral adjustment screw is placed under a plastic cap. To gain access to this screw, you'll have to take off the caps made of plastic using a screwdriver, loosening them until there is enough room for movement.
You can also use hinges that are plain butt, which are attached to the frame by pins at the hinge knuckles. In this instance you'll need to loosen the bottom/top screws using a screwdriver to get sideways movement, however, be sure to not completely remove them since you will have to return them later. Once you have achieved the desired amount of movement, tighten the screws in order to secure the hinge.
After you've completed the adjustment process, test your composite door paint repair door. If not, repeat the process until it is perfectly aligned and shuts without resistance or creaking. Additionally, it is a good idea to periodically lubricate your hinges to prevent them from becoming stiff or prone to creaking.
Maintenance
Utilizing a mild soap or solution of warm water and Composite Door Hinge Replacement vinegar is a good way to clean composite door hinges. It is important to avoid using cleaning techniques that are abrasive because they can harm the surface of the hinges. Regular inspections of doors and hinges can help you identify any potential issues before they cause damage or require replacement.
It is recommended, in addition to regular cleaning and checking the hinges, to lubricate them frequently. A silicone-based lubricant is a good way to improve the functionality of your hinges and avoid the squeaks that occur. It also protects your hinges from environmental and moisture factors. It is a good idea to check the type of lubricant suggested by the manufacturer of your hinge for best results.
It is also recommended to look over the door frame and weather stripping for signs of wear and tear. Keeping the weather stripping in good condition will reduce drafts and maintain an encapsulated seal around the door made of composite. It is also recommended to regularly replacing the weatherstripping in order to ensure it functions properly and extend its life.
The most common issues that could cause problems for the operation of composite door frame repair doors are problems closing or opening the door, sticking or scraping on the floor and misalignment. A simple hinge adjustment will aid in resolving these issues and restore the door's functionality.
Adjustments to hinges can be done by anyone with a basic understanding of home improvement and DIY skills. It is crucial to understand the kind of hinge you are using and have the proper tools before beginning any adjustments. Incorrect adjustment methods can damage the hinges and door frame, causing more problems in the future.
Depending on the type of hinges, they can be adjusted in three different ways: height, compression, and lateral movement. The most effective way to adjust the hinges on a door made of composite door replacement is to remove the caps made of plastic from the top and bottom of the hinge to gain access to the inner workings. Once the hinge pins are cleaned and lubricated, the screws can be tightened to securely fasten the components.
Replacement
The hinges of your composite door are crucial for its function, security, and aesthetics. If they aren't properly aligned your door could be difficult to close and open, and Composite Door Hinge Replacement you might hear squeaking noises when opening and shutting it. Regular maintenance and a proper adjustment can avoid these issues.
To begin, you'll have to determine the kind of hinges you have on your composite front door replacement door. This will allow you to know the exact adjustments required. It is important to have the appropriate tools to complete the task. These tools can include screwdrivers and Allen keys, based on the hinge's design. It is recommended to seek professional assistance if you're not confident in making these adjustments yourself. This reduces the chance of damaging your door or frame, as well as the possibility of injury.
Start by loosening the screws on the top of the hinge plates attached to the door frames with a screwdriver, or spanners depending on the hinge design. This will allow you to access the horizontal and vertical adjustment screws. You will need to adjust both of them to achieve an even gap. Once you've done this, you will need tighten the screws a second time.
If the gap is still uneven, you can repeat this procedure on the opposite side of the door. Continue to adjust both the horizontal and vertical adjustment screw until the door is level and snug within the frame. Check that the handles and any other hardware are securely fixed.
To maintain the integrity of doors made of composite It is essential to regularly adjust them. Proper adjustment will help to avoid the most common issues with doors, such as stretching or warping. Regular cleaning and lubrication can also help keep your door in good working condition. If you follow these suggestions you can tighten your door and reduce creaks.
